When our team arrived at the Waterville home, we performed a thorough inspection of the basement structure. The basement measured approximately 40 feet by 25 feet, and nearly 95 feet of the block wall showed signs of shearing, a condition where the lower courses of block begin sliding horizontally over one another.

This type of movement is often caused by long-term lateral pressure from surrounding soil combined with moisture intrusion. While the walls had not yet bowed significantly or cracked beyond repair, the shearing was an ongoing issue that would only worsen if left unaddressed. Catching it early was critical, as delaying repairs could eventually require full wall replacement or excavation, both far more invasive and costly solutions.

Crafting the Right Solution

Because the issue was concentrated along the lower portion of the walls, our team recommended a core fill and reinforcement system designed to strengthen the block from the inside and stabilize the shifting courses.

The repair plan focused on reinforcing the bottom of the basement walls using a precise, engineered approach. We began by coring selected block cells based on a grid layout and block testing results. This allowed us to target the areas under the most stress without unnecessary disruption to the rest of the foundation.

Next, we installed vertical steel reinforcement inside the cored sections. These reinforcements help lock the block courses together, preventing further sliding and distributing pressure more evenly along the wall. Once the reinforcement was in place, the open block cells were grout-filled, creating solid, reinforced columns within the wall structure.

The scope of work included approximately 20 feet of wall reinforced at three block courses high and 75 feet reinforced at two block courses high, ensuring adequate stabilization across all affected areas. After completing the reinforcement, the basement walls were fully stabilized, stopping the shearing and restoring structural integrity. This type of repair not only prevents further movement but also protects the home’s long-term value by addressing the root of the problem before visible damage spreads.

For the homeowner in Waterville, OH, the results meant peace of mind. With the lower block walls reinforced and strengthened, the risk of more serious structural failure was greatly reduced. Just as important, the repair avoided the need for major excavation or wall replacement, saving time, money, and disruption.
